Hi all. I'm new here and relatively new to web design and am now looking to take my skills onto a new level.

As a budding new web designer, I'm now considering which software is best. My assumption was that I'd have to go with Adobe. However, after reading a few comments on here, there are some who consider it to be too expensive given that there are other options out there which could also be better.

I was hoping for advice from experienced people who could let me know if you think Adobe is the way to go or recommend any other software.

Hello Fionaer, if financial isn't an issue, purchase the Adobe. Less expensive good one is Corel Paintshop, a lot of the graphic artists are using both softwares. For the money, Corel is a good start.

Gimp is a freeware and has a lot of nice functions.

I can also recommend you GIMP. It's a favorite graphics editing program of many designers and graphic artists. Besides, it is free and compatible with Windows, Mac and Linux. There are many features, plug-ins, filters and brushes in it. So, you can try it and decide yourself

If you need graphic editor ONLY for webdesign, try Adobe Fireworks (formerly Macromedia Fireworks)
Fireworks inexpensive and has many webdesign-specific functions

as mentioned: for web graphics only (i.e. not print) then fireworks would be my weapon of choice. if budgets tight then gimp/inkscape (both free)
